RUSSIAN EXECUTIONER DIES IN RED GAOL.
| By T«le£r*plv Press Asan- —Copyright. Aue. and N.Z. Cable Association. (Received January 18, 13.5 p.m.) MOSCOW, January 17. I M Shabin. former Bolshevik executioner, died in prison, having been recently sentenced to ten yeAi s gaol for embezzlement. Shabin m five years exceeded 500 executions. He was an expert shot with _ the revolver, with which executions in Russia are still carried out. The condemned man is stripped except for shirt. and is shot through the back of the head. 1
